Ronaldo was not on Al Nassr's squad list for this match, as Portuguese media had reported. The Portuguese forward was reportedly displeased with the management of the Public Investment Fund (PIF), claiming Al Nassr did not receive comparable investment and preferential treatment compared to direct competitors. Against Al Riyadh, Al Nassr was without Ronaldo, Kingsley Coman, and Marcelo Brozovic. However, the visiting team still secured three points thanks to two other European-seasoned stars: Joao Felix and Sadio Mane.

In the 40th minute, Felix threaded a pass for Mane, who broke the offside trap, raced down, and volleyed into the near corner past goalkeeper Milan Borjan. Al Nassr dominated the match, controlling possession 67% and taking 10 shots with 3 on target, compared to Al Riyadh's 7 shots and one on target. Coach Jorge Jesus's team could have won by a larger margin if they had been more clinical.
In the 18th minute, from a corner kick, Mane attempted an overhead kick that went just wide of the post. In the 80th minute, Felix nearly secured a second assist when his cross allowed Al Ghannam to head the ball against Al Riyadh's woodwork. Al Riyadh also had reasons for regret, as they had the ball in Al Nassr's net two times from shots by Okou in the 39th minute and Toze in the 82nd minute, but both were disallowed for offside. In the fourth minute of second-half stoppage time, Felix again assisted the Senegalese forward, who broke free and struck a diagonal shot into the net. However, the goal was disallowed for offside.
The joy doubled for Al Nassr when, in a later match, league leaders Al Hilal were held to a 0-0 draw by Al Ahli at home. These results allowed Al Nassr to close the gap with Al Hilal to one point, reigniting their title hopes. In the next round, Al Hilal will visit Al Akhdoud, while Al Nassr will face Al Ittihad, a club boasting stars like Karim Benzema, Moussa Diaby, Houssem Aouar, N'Golo Kante, and Fabinho. Ronaldo's potential return for this match remains unclear.
